Flavour and Scent
The aroma of black truffle/truffles is unique as well as probably one of the most unique culinary fragrance worldwide.


" Taste on the tongue is the normal sweet, sour, bitter, salted and "umami" (savoury), however the nose is a lot more discriminatory and also taste is 90% scent. There are thousands of notes, to an experienced nose and the scent of T. melanosporum (black truffle) is moldy as well as sweet, a really extreme mushroom odor overlaid with various other notes, specifically what red wine cups call "forest floor". It accepts the flavours in food enhancing and magnifying them. A steak with truffle sauce ends up being meatier, eggs are changed right into an exquisite product, and also every element of the dish ends up being much more gratifying."

There are 2 things of culinary worth about truffle/truffles The very first is the exotic aroma, and also taste is 90% fragrance. When saved with fatty food compounds, the truffle fragrance is used up by the fats. Think eggs, fresh oily nuts or chocolate, as well as cream or just grape seed oil.

The second is that truffle consists of glutamic acid, a flavour enhancer. truffle/truffles make any kind of food taste much better. When the aroma has actually gone, do not throw it out, slice it and put it under the skin of a chicken before roasting, insert slivers of truffle in chicken wing sticks or add it to a soup or stew and let the glutamate kick in!

How to save truffle/truffles
truffle/truffles are best saved in the fridge in a huge airtight container such as a container or zip leading bag, to avoid the scent from contaminating other ingredients in the refrigerator. Cover each truffle in a paper towel to keep them completely dry. When harvested, truffle/truffles will certainly continue to lose moisture, weight and scent, as well as are best used within 3 weeks of harvest.

Do make certain you check the paper towel daily to quit the truffle from coming to be damp. If the black truffle expands a little white mould, brush it off under running cold water and completely dry the truffle completely before changing it in the refrigerator.

truffle/truffles can also be maintained by blast cold them (minus forty levels Celsius), yet these will have much less of the aroma of a fresh truffle. If frozen, truffle/truffles must then be kept/used/shaved, frozen as they end up being rubbery when defrosted.

Serving truffle/truffles.
Unlike Europe, Australia has yet to establish a 'Truffle Culture', so new consumers are best captivated by the full experience of seeing fresh truffle/truffles as well as smelling it on home plate.

truffle/truffles opt for almost anything as they are a taste booster and also have the 'umami', or mouth-watering taste. They complement simple recipes entailing eggs, mushrooms, poultry, pasta, potatoes, risotto, Jerusalem artichokes as well as celeriac but the opportunities are limitless. truffle/truffles have a wonderful fondness for any fats that will certainly keep the scent-- such as truffle butter or cream-based sauces. You can discover some truffle dishes below.

When shaving a truffle, it must be cut as very finely as possible, as the greater the area subjected, the higher the scent from the truffle serving. Truffle razors reveal the texture and also marbling of pieces as well as microplanes work for finely divided truffle required for instilling with cream or in making truffle butter.

Why truffle/truffles are priced different to various other mushrooms
To aid you value the reason truffle costs differ from period to period as well as why truffle/truffles are valued (and valued!) as they are, allow's take you "behind-the-scenes".

As you might recognize, black truffle/truffles are not as common as their various other fungi relatives. It takes years before the very first indicator of a truffle may appear. truffle/truffles can only expand under particular weather problems, hence you won't locate them expanding everywhere They are the fruiting body of a mycorrhizal fungis expanding on the origins of a specific host tree, frequently oak or hazelnut trees for the black truffle, in a symbiotic relationship with the tree. For growers, this is not farming for the light-hearted. It calls for a sound expertise or access to the most effective recommendations, all of which is based on relevant experience from all expanding nations of the globe as well as specifically the current expanding experience in Australia. The thrill will certainly pertain to a top with harvest of the first truffle during the crisp as well as at times cutting cool truffle season from late May to late August. This is truffle harvesting time in Australia.

While the initial harvest might be from 4 to 8 years after planting, the yield from any kind of specific tree will vary. The specially experienced harvest canines are made use of to determine truffle area as well as the delicate process of discovering, inspection and also harvesting happens.

Our growers invest numerous hrs on their hands and knees, very carefully excavating the truffle/truffles, with a treatment and precision not unlike that seen on an archaeological dig. What we find should be looked for ripeness, and if it is not yet prepared for collecting, left uninterrupted, protected as well as rechecked at a later time. If collected prematurely, not just do they have none of their dark colouring, yet the shelf life, pungent fragrance and also culinary possibility is missing, significantly destructive investment returns.
